Classical SING MOVE PLAY

Music

Discover how classical music and kids go hand in hand. Classical Sing Move Play classes are available for train the trainer models, digital experiences, and in person bookings. 45 minute classes explore opera, symphonic works, and cultural folks songs from around the world.

Storytime

Featuring books written by Alisa Magallón, this 30 minute singing story time program explores rhyming and singing paired with theatrical interpretations of text. Includes extension activities that promote collaboration and creativity, through the visual arts and social emotional learning. Spanish/English bilingual available for select titles.


About

Connecting people through music, creating empathy through listening, and sharing hope through inspiring ideas...

Alisa Magallón M.M, is a dynamic leader, musician, and arts administrator. She is the founder of Classical Sing Move Play, LLC and a highly sought-after consultant for community engagement and arts programming nationally, with a strong focus in Houston, TX. Magallón has led education and community engagement efforts for nonprofit arts organizations since 2009, predominantly with Houston Grand Opera, Minnesota Opera, and Young Audiences of Houston.Recent clients include: Opera Montana, Museum of Fine Arts Houston, Houston Symphony, Houston Methodist Hospital, Michael E. DeBakey VA Medical Center, Woodlands Pavilion Center, Harris County Public Libraries, Discovery Green, Children’s Museum Houston, Fort Bend Discovery Center, and Hobby Center for the Performing Arts.She is the author of several children's books, a board member of the Houston Boychoir, and sits on the leadership committee for Arts Connect Houston. Alisa hold degrees from Luther College and Northwestern Univeristy.
